Taking soil colloid and hydrated silica (quartz sand) as the experimental material, thecomparative study has been made on the kinetics of ion diffusion and ion exchange in chargedcolloid and charged coarse disperse systems. The results showed that ion exchange kinetics in thetwo systems conform to the kinetic law of ion diffusion. Besides, through this comparative studyon the kinetics of ion exchange and ion diffusion, a method has been advanced theoretically toestimate the quantity of adsorbed ion that is located in the inner of the Helmholtz layer. As far ashydrated silica is concerned , there were about 33 per cent of the total adsorbed quantity of Mg2+that were located in the inner of the Helmholtz layer under the given experimental conditions, butfor soil colloid tlle pcrcentage was only 7.5.
